Code B1E50 Dodge Description
What are the Possible Causes of the DTC B1E50 Dodge?
- Faulty Right Stow/Tailgate Position Sensor
- Right Stow/Tailgate Position Sensor harness is open or shorted
- Right Stow/Tailgate Position Sensor circuit poor electrical connection
- Faulty Right Power Rear Folding Seat Stow Motor
- Faulty Power Rear Folding Seat Module
How to Fix the DTC B1E50 Dodge?
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.
What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?
Labor: 1.0
To diagnose the B1E50 Dodge code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80β$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.
